1992 Dodge Viper vs. 2012 Holden Colorado
To start off, 2012 Holden Colorado is newer by 20 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Dodge Viper.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Dodge Viper would be higher. At 7,990 cc (10 cylinders), 1992 Dodge Viper is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Dodge Viper (359 HP) has 198 more horse power than 2012 Holden Colorado. (161 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1992 Dodge Viper should accelerate faster than 2012 Holden Colorado.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Dodge Viper (620 Nm) has 260 more torque (in Nm) than 2012 Holden Colorado. (360 Nm). This means 1992 Dodge Viper will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2012 Holden Colorado.
